I had never grown Veronica spicata at a large scale until this year and I absolutely loved it. With a very long bloom period and lengthy blue flower spires, it’s a great garden plant and/or cut flower. Requires no staking despite its height. (A solid 4.5’ at our farm) It was one of our top plants for pollinators, sometimes with 3-4 bumblebees on each spire. Plant this with Mignonette and Phacelia and you might have quite the show of beneficial insects!. Low water needs and tolerant of lean soil.
